PM Counter Reset 7804
Clears the paper counter (SP7-803-001).
Next Life Limit (End of Life settings) 7805
Shows when you must replace the unit or component. These SPs indicate the
total number of images or pages. For example, you must replace the transfer
roller when the total counter reaches 400,000 pages. These SPs are updated
when you execute PM Parts Clear (SP7-905). For example, SP7-805-008
displays "800,000 pages" when you execute PM Parts Clear.
7805 001 PC (K) Default: 400,000 images
7805 002 PC (C) Default: 400,000 images
7805 003 PC (M) Default: 400,000 images
7805 004 PC (Y) Default: 400,000 images
7805 005 OPC Belt Default: 400,000 images
7805 006 Fusing Default: 400,000 pages
7805 007 Transfer Belt Default: 400,000 images
7805 008 Transfer Roller Default: 400,000 pages
7805 009 Waste Toner Bottle Default: 400,000 images
7805 011 Pickup Roller Default: 400,000 pages
7805 012 Pickup Roller 2 Default: 400,000 pages
